The transition from hippie vendors to a billion-dollar corporation was neither swift nor linear. In 1980, Mackey and a small group of investors opened the first Whole Foods Market in Austin, Texas. The store was an immediate anomaly in the retail landscape, focusing exclusively on natural and organic products at a time when such terms were niche curiosities rather than mainstream marketing slogans. The company operated on principles that seemed idealistic, if not naive, in the profit-driven 1980s: prioritizing product quality and sourcing standards over sheer volume, and treating employees with a respect that bordered on the radical. While competitors chased market share through aggressive pricing, Mackey was busy cultivating a culture he termed "conscious capitalism." He viewed the business not merely as a mechanism for generating profit, but as a vehicle for improving the world. This philosophy was detailed in his book *Conscious Capitalism*, co-authored with his business partner, Professor Raj Sisodia, where he argued that a higher purpose is the key to sustainable business success. For Mackey, profits were not the enemy of purpose but the fuel that allowed that purpose to thrive, a concept that set him apart from the traditional Wall Street titans of his era.

One of the primary advantages of engaging with coloring pages, specifically those featuring livestock like cows, is the development of fine motor skills. For children, the act of gripping a crayon, marker, or colored pencil and attempting to stay within the lines is a crucial exercise in hand-eye coordination. When individuals or businesses evaluate their overall financial condition, they often look at their net worth. This figure provides a snapshot of assets minus liabilities, offering a clear picture of wealth. However, a deeper and more insightful metric exists that provides a more immediate view of financial health: liquid net worth. Understanding the distinction between liquid net worth vs net worth is not just a matter of semantics; it is a critical distinction that affects financial planning, risk management, and the ability to navigate economic uncertainties.
